How to Clean the Burners of your Gas Hob / Stove
- Turn off all your gas burners and allow the stove to cool down completely before cleaning to prevent yourself from getting burned or injured.
- Fill your sink or wash basin with hot water and add enough liquid dish-washing soap to create a sudsy soapy mixture.

- Remove your stove’s gas surface burners and place them in the water and soap mixture to soak for several minutes or until existing grime can be easily wiped away.
- Use a cleaning rag to clean the surface burners after they have soaked for several minutes.
- Use a straight pin to clean the inside of the holes of the surface burners where the gas flames are emitted.
- Rinse your surface burners thoroughly in hot water to rinse off any remaining soap or suds.
- Place your gas surface burners upside-down on a clean dry towel to allow them to dry completely.
- Replace or install your gas surface burners back onto your stove top after they have dried completely.
How to Clean the Grids of your Gas Hob / Stove
- Fill a wash basin or sink with warm water and add liquid dish-washing soap to make a cleaning solution for your burner grids.
- Use a soft non-abrasive sponge or pad to clean away any grime or debris from each of your burner grates.
- Use baking soda paste to scrub away stains or grime that is difficult to clean with the soap and water mixture.
- Rinse your burner grids under warm clean water and place them on a clean towel to dry completely before replacing them on the stove-top.
How to clean surface of your Gas Hob / Stove
- Remove your gas burner grids and set them aside.
- Remove and dispose of large pieces or chunks of dried food and debris that have collected under the grates such as grains of rice or charred meat.
- Spray your entire gas stove top surface with glass cleaner or a soap and warm-water mixture.
- Use a sponge or soft cloth to spread your cleaning solution around the stove-top and to scrub away any existing tough stains.
- Use a clean dry cloth to remove any excess cleaning solution.
- Replace the gas stove burner grids to their original spots when you have finished cleaning.
Gas Hob / Stove Caution
- Electrical socket for Hobs should not be near to cylinder area / gas pipeline area.
- Do not put kitchen drawer below the hob as it may damage the nozzle resulting in gas leakage / accident.
- Do not pull the chord to disconnect the plug. Remove the plug itself from the socket.
- Glass used in all appliances is a tempered glass will only break and crystallize on impact hence avoid any impact on the glass.
- Change battery of your hob for uninterrupted usage of Auto ignition every 6 months (1.5 V D type Battery)if your hob has battery operated ignition.
- Do not leave acid or alkaline substances such as vinegar gravy/ curry salt sugar or lemon juice on the hob.
- Electrical socket for Hobs should not be near to cylinder area.
- Do not flambe food under the hood. Naked flames could cause fire.
- Do not wash Built in Hob with water as it can damage Auto ignition generator and there is chance of electric shock.
- Do not attempt to dismantle the built in product.
- Any food spills (water gravy coffee tea milk oil etc.) on the built in product should be wiped away before they dry.
- Do Not Use any Cooking Utensils/Aids which cover the Burners & Touch the Glass of Built-in Hob or Cook-top for eg. Bati Cooker Kalevala Gas Tandoori Gas oven Paniyarrakal Maker Charcoal Chimney lighter etc.
- Metallic/ colored glass cooktops are prone to dis-coloration if Bati Cooker Kaladu Gas Tandoori Gas oven Paniyarrakal Maker Charcoal Chimney lighter etc or any such utensils covering the burner are used hence do not use such utensils.
- Gas Built in Hob / Cook-top must be used in well ventilated room .
- To optimize the usage of your Hob placing correct vessel on the burner is important. Ensure the Vessel base Diameter is larger than the burner. Usage of Flat bottom vessels avoids wastage of fuel.
- Gas consumption is directly related to the usage and correct usage of vessels.
- Do not use multiple plug adapters or extension board in case of built in product.
- Do not use abrasive or corrosive products chlorine-based cleaner or hard rubbing for built in.
- Do not use the steam/ vapor cleaning appliances.
- Do not allow children to use the appliance without supervision.
- Please peel the protective (PVC) film before using any appliance. PVC is inflammable.
How to clean Kitchen Chimney
The Fista Auto Clean Kitchen chimney clears the air of smoke and grease from everyday cooking but they can leave their mark. Over time stains can build up and vents can clog. Clean the exterior of the hood weekly and the filters monthly. Incase there is Protective PVC film on the kitchen hood please peel before using.
Exterior can be cleaned with any cleaner like CIF or with mild detergent and warm water. Do not scrub with hard scrubbers as they will scratch the surface of hood. Before cleaning the Auto Clean Kitchen chimney please ensure the Gas Hob burners are OFF and Auto Clean Kitchen chimney power supply is switched off. Frequency of cleaning depends on usage etc. Do not use abrasive / acid based cleaning agents.
How to clean Kitchen Chimney Scrub Filters
Remove the Metal filters carefully please ensure the gas stove burner are not ON while removing Filters. Soak them in mild detergent and warm water for 1 hr . Brush with a nylon scrub brush. Rinse in hot water and dry. Some filters can be washed in the dishwasher. Dry the filters before placing them back in the kitchen hood. Filters should be cleaned depending in usage. For heavy oily cooking filters should be cleaned on weekly basis. For kitchen hood with oil collector oil collector should be removed carefully please ensure the gas stove burner are not ON while removing Oil collector. Oil collector should be washed with soap & water wiped clean with cloth. Replace oil collector in place.
How to clean Kitchen Chimney Interior
The hood clears the air of smoke and grease from everyday cooking but they can leave their mark. Over time stains can build up and vents can clog. Clean the Kitchen Chimney Interior of the hood with help of authorized technician. Frequency of cleaning depends on Usage.
Fista Kitchen Chimney Caution
- Do not pull the chord to disconnect the plug. Remove the plug itself from the socket.
- Do not flambe food under the hood. Naked flames could cause fire.
- Do not use multiple plug adapters or extension board in case of built in product.
- The hood must be installed exactly above the Built in Hob . Also ensure Kitchen-hood is of same size or larger than the Hob/ cook-top.
- The minimum safety distance between the Hood and cook-top is 650 mm in case of electric cooker and 750 mm in case of gas burner.For vertical hoods distance between gas burner a Kitchen-hood should be 450 mm – 550 mm max.
- Do not leave pans unattainable when frying. Cooking oil can catch fire.
- Never use flammable materials duct to extract air from hood.
- Please peel the protective (PVC) film before using any appliance. PVC is inflammable.
